The teachers stayed for about a month in each district. - Long ago people used to say that it was unlucky to get married on certain days of the week.
An old rhyme ran thus:-
Monday for health
Tuesday for wealth
Wednesday the best of all
Thursday for losses
Friday for crosses and Saturday no luck at all.(continues on next page)
